A door lock actuator that isn't working properly could be a sign of trouble

Door lock actuators that fail to function properly are a frequent issue. It is important to know the reasons behind it so that you can fix it. There are many possible causes for a door lock actuator to fail, which include corrosion oil, dirt and debris. When these materials get into the mechanical links, they react with moisture to form rust, which weakens them and eventually leads to the failure of the actuator.

If you find that the door lock doesn't open or close, you should investigate the power supply for the door lock actuator. Through wires, the actuator is connected to primary power output of the door panel. The door locking system will not work if these wires are cut or the door panel is damaged. Fortunately, fixing this issue is fairly easy.

Water that gets into the door lock actuator can also be a problem. Water can get into the door and trigger the anti-theft alarm. To address this issue, you can either replace the door lock actuator or cover the connector with a seal.

To replace a door lock actuator, remove the door's panel and unscrew the screws and cables that are attached to the actuator. When you remove the door panel be careful not to cause damage to the cables. After that, reconnect the cables and check for a click. If the clicking sound is heard when unlocking or locking the doors of the driver manually then the door lock actuator is receiving the power. If the clicking sound isn't heard it is possible that the grounding system is the problem.

A defective door lock actuator could cause issues with power locks and keys. Even though you might be able to unlock the doors using a key, button or keyfob to open them, you will need to do so manually. A weak actuator will also cause the doors to lock inconsistently and partially.

The door lock actuator is an electrically powered device which sends an indication to the power door lock. Without this device the door lock system powered by power won't function properly and the replacement car Door locks will be unfit to use.

How to fix a defective door lock actuator

If your door lock isn't working correctly There are a few steps to be taken to determine if the issue is the door lock actuator. The first step is to check if the actuator is damaged or jammed. Also, check the child safety lock. If the lock does not perform as it should, you might need to replace the actuator.

The actuator could be difficult to reach. Try applying 12 V to it using jumper wires or a Power Probe. You can also take the door apart to look for broken lines. A broken line means that the door lock actuator won't receive the electric current it requires.

A damaged door lock actuator can be an issue that is frequent and can be difficult to determine whether it's the door lock actuator itself. If it's the door lock mechanism, then you'll have to examine the other components as well. If they're operating properly, it should be easy to replace the door lock actuator. A malfunctioning door lock actuator may signal a more serious problem.

It is best to get the door lock actuator replaced by a professional when it's damaged. The repair could cost up to $120 or more according to the type of actuator. However, you may be able to locate OEM parts for a reasonable price if you know where to find them. You may have to buy an aftermarket component if you cannot locate the part you require. However, you should be aware that these are not universal and are likely to not work with your car.

A faulty door lock actuator can stop the door lock's power from functioning effectively. It can also cause the lock to behave in unpredictable ways. It may also make unusual noises when it is operating. In some cases, the door lock may be able to operate but it's sluggish or intermittent.

Replacing a faulty door lock key repair near me actuator

You can easily replace the door lock controller that is damaged at home. But, you'll need remove the door panel to complete the task. It is important that you do this without damaging the door. Then, you must examine the lock system assembly to determine what is not working correctly.

First, you must determine if your actuator has failed. This will cause the door lock mechanism to stop working, and your car door locks will not lock. This isn't a cause for actual danger, but will cause a lot of inconvenience. This issue can be resolved by removal of the door's door and examining the lock mechanism.

Then, find the actuator. It's typically attached to the door lock car repair latch assembly using screws or clips made of plastic. To remove the actuator, you'll need mirrors and curved picks. If your vehicle is older, you might have an additional actuator.

If your car has a power door lock system the issue is most likely due to a malfunctioning door lock actuator or switch. To determine if the problem is caused by the actuator's power supply and how to check it, you should test it. To access the actuator, one will need to remove the door panel. Safety glasses are recommended.

Once you've discovered the issue with the door lock actuator you'll need to decide if you'll require replacing it with an entirely new actuator. Although it will cost you more but it will make your car lock repairs more practical. Jumper wires can be used to supply 12 volts to the actuator in order to verify its power source.

Replacing a damaged door lock mechanism will cost you about $120 - depending on the model and year of your car. Aftermarket parts are available, but they're not universal, and can cost you between $50-$110. Regardless of which option you pick be aware that these components can fail after many miles of use.

You could have a malfunctioning door lock actuator if been hearing unusual noises from your door's inside. The actuator is controlled by a set of gears, and a motor. If any of these components fail it could be an indication of a larger problem. A broken door lock actuator indicates that the gears or motor may be worn out or have malfunctions. It is recommended to replace the actuator immediately if you suspect that it's malfunctioning.
